Understanding EV Fleet Management Solution 


An EV fleet management system helps you take care of your electric vehicle fleet. It is a combination of computer programs and hardware that monitor and manage different parts of your EV fleet. Unlike regular gas-powered vehicles that you can just refill at a gas station, electric vehicles need to be charged at special charging stations, at your company's depot (main location), or even at the drivers' homes. EV fleet management systems help you plan when and where to charge your vehicles so they never run out of battery.

Key Features and Benefits of Electric Vehicle Fleet Management Solution 


1. Battery Monitoring and Charge Management: These systems constantly check the battery levels of all your electric vehicles. They let you know when a vehicle needs to be charged. They also help you plan the best times and places to charge each vehicle, based on things like how much battery is left, the route the vehicle will take, and where the nearest charging stations are.


2. Route Optimization: By using GPS tracker and map technology, EV fleet management systems can plan the most efficient routes for your electric vehicles. They consider things like battery range, charging station locations, and traffic conditions. This way, your vehicles can complete their deliveries or service calls without running out of charge, and you avoid wasting time and money.


3. Predictive Maintenance: Using advanced computer programs, these systems can predict when an electric vehicle might need maintenance or repairs. This allows you to schedule maintenance before anything breaks down, saving you from unexpected problems and costs.


4. Remote Diagnostics and Updates: Many EV fleet management systems can check the health of your vehicles from a distance and even update their software remotely. This means you don't have to bring the vehicles in for simple updates or diagnostics, saving you time and effort.


5. Fleet Analytics and Reporting: These systems provide detailed reports and data analysis on how your fleet is performing. You can see things like energy usage, driver behavior, and cost savings. This helps you make better decisions to improve efficiency and save money.

7. Lower Per-Mile Energy Costs: Electricity typically costs significantly less than gasoline or diesel on a per-mile basis. This disparity is due to the higher efficiency of electric motors compared to internal combustion engines. While the cost of electricity varies by region, the general trend indicates substantial savings over time.


8. Stable Electricity Prices: The price of electricity is usually more stable compared to the often volatile prices of gasoline and diesel. This stability can allow businesses to predict and control their operational costs more effectively.


9. Government Incentives: Many government provide subsidies for purchasing EVs, reduced taxation, and incentives for installing charging infrastructure. These incentives can further reduce the total cost of ownership for electric vehicles.


10. Regenerative Braking: EVs benefit from regenerative braking systems that recover energy typically lost during braking and return it to the battery. This efficiency increase is particularly beneficial for delivery vehicles in urban environments with frequent stops and starts, extending the range and potentially reducing energy costs further.


12. Lower Maintenance Costs: EVs have fewer moving parts than internal combustion engine vehicles, leading to lower maintenance costs. Though not directly related to fuel savings, this aspect contributes to the overall cost-effectiveness of electric vehicles.


13. Peak Demand Charging Strategies: Some businesses can further reduce their energy costs by charging their EV fleets during off-peak hours, when electricity rates are lower. Smart charging strategies and technologies can optimize charging schedules to take advantage of these lower rates.


14. Renewable Energy Integration: Businesses that invest in renewable energy sources like solar or wind to power their EV charging stations can achieve additional savings and further reduce their carbon footprint.
